It uses mandelic acid — an AHA with a larger molecular structure — to provide gentler chemical exfoliation that’s often better tolerated by sensitive and reactive skin types. A low dose of retinol supports cellular turnover while glycerin keeps the skin hydrated during treatment, making the product suitable for a variety of skin tones and textures.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eHow does mandelic acid help reduce hyperpigmentation?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Mandelic acid is an alpha hydroxy acid that exfoliates the surface layer of the skin, helping to disperse excess melanin and reveal a more even tone. Its larger molecular size means it penetrates more slowly, lowering irritation risk compared with smaller AHAs.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003e10% concentration targets dark spots and discoloration.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eGentle, gradual exfoliation reduces flaking and redness.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eSuitable for more sensitive skin types than glycolic acid.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eWhy combine 0.1% retinol with mandelic acid?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eA low-strength retinol complements mandelic acid by promoting natural cell turnover beneath the surface, which helps fade longstanding marks over time. The modest 0.1% level balances efficacy with tolerability to reduce the chance of irritation when used correctly.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eSupports deeper renewal alongside surface exfoliation.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eLow retinol concentration minimizes peeling and dryness.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eWorks best at night and when layered under moisturiser.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eHow do I include this treatment in my evening routine?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eApply the treatment in your PM routine on clean, dry skin as the last treatment step.
